Definition and purpose of a network switch.

A network switch, also known as a LAN switch, is a networking device that connects multiple computers and other network devices together. Its primary purpose is to facilitate communication and data exchange within a local area network (LAN). Unlike a network hub, which broadcasts data to all connected devices, a network switch forwards data only to the intended recipient.

Network switches play a crucial role in network performance and efficiency. Switches provide a dedicated connection for each device, minimizing network congestion and improving data transfer speeds. Additionally, they offer advanced features such as VLAN support, QoS (Quality of Service), and port security, enhancing network flexibility and security.

Relevant Technologies for Allowing Multiple Networks to Traverse a Switch

To establish seamless communication between multiple networks while maintaining network integrity, various technologies are employed to enable traffic to traverse a switch. These technologies play a crucial role in ensuring data reliability and network efficiency.

One such technology is Virtual Local Area Networks (VLANs), which logically segments a physical network into multiple virtual networks, isolating traffic and enhancing security. Each VLAN acts as a separate broadcast domain, preventing traffic from one VLAN from reaching another. By implementing VLANs, network administrators can create logical network boundaries, improving network performance and security.

Another key technology is Spanning Tree Protocol (STP), which prevents network loops and ensures data integrity. STP establishes a loop-free topology by blocking redundant paths, ensuring that traffic flows along a single, designated path. This prevents network instability and data loss, maintaining network reliability.

In addition to VLANs and STP, Trunking is employed to aggregate multiple physical links into a single logical link, increasing bandwidth and flexibility. Trunking allows for the transmission of multiple VLANs over a single physical link, optimizing network utilization and reducing cabling complexity.

Furthermore, Rapid Spanning Tree Protocol (RSTP) enhances the speed of STP convergence, minimizing network downtime during topology changes. By rapidly recalculating the spanning tree, RSTP ensures faster network recovery, improving network resilience.

These technologies, among others, are essential for enabling multiple networks to traverse a switch effectively. By implementing these solutions, network administrators can create flexible, secure, and reliable network environments that meet the demands of modern networking.
